On 12/06/2012 10:22 PM, Bruce Fischl wrote:
> Hi Knut
> the tiffs written by tksurfer are 600x600 regardless of what DPI you 
> set. You can change the dpi with convert (or photoshop), but it won't 
> change the # of pixels.
